House Secretariat to promote youth participation in democracy development

d.jpg

BANGKOK, 29 December 2015 (NNT) – The Secretariat of the House of Representatives will hold a reconciliation and participation promoting campaign among the youth, to strengthening the democratic system of the country.

The House Secretariat is set to hold two seminars for high school, vocational education, and university students with the objective to instill an integrated set of knowledge to promote participation in the country's development progress from the public, through the network of the secretariat.

Students aged between 15-20 years are eligible to apply for the seminars, which will take place on 22-31 March 2016 and 19-28 April 2016, at the TOT Academy in Nonthaburi Province.

Candidates must show their interest or have participated in school activities before, such as being the president of student committee or club, possess the capability to do research for community benefits, and must not have participated in the Democratic Youth activity before. Participants are required to have strong health, and are able to join the entire 10-day activity.

Interested students can inquire for more information at the House Secretariat, Bangkok, tel 0 2244 2515 – 16, or 0 2244 2522.
